The “Walk Around the Block” webinar series addresses design challenges and trending topics relative to power electronics applications. In this series, we’ll focus on EV fast charging and highlight a variety of topics from our vendors:
- Wolfspeed: On-board chargers
- u-blox: Wireless communications
- Analog Devices: Optimize switching
- Microchip Technology Inc.: Power factor correction
Each session is only 20-minutes which makes it easier to fit into your busy day.

The power conversion stage in EV fast chargers along with system design challenges posed by optimized switching and protection requirements of SiC devices are discussed in detail. This webinar from Analog Devices and Richardson RFPD investigates mitigating these challenges using optimal isolated gate driver selection. Attendees will also learn relevant solutions in the power management and interface space.

u-blox explores the drivers for wireless communication in the EV-charging market. After presenting suitable technologies and standards as well as design considerations, the presenters will delve into the central role wireless communication plays in enabling a growing number of EV-charging use cases.

Learn with Microchip Technology Inc. about design considerations for minimizing commutation loop inductance, achieving low switching losses and an efficient thermal design, all addressed with Microchip’s 30kW Vienna PFC reference design.
